Writing SEO-friendly content is an important aspect of search engine optimization (SEO). It involves creating content that is optimized for both search engines and users. This can help improve the visibility of your website in search engine results pages (SERPs) and increase the likelihood that your content will be clicked on and read by users.

Here are some tips and tools you can use to write SEO-friendly content:

  1. Use relevant keywords: Identify the keywords that are relevant to your business and include them in your content in a natural way. This can help search engines understand what your content is about and improve its ranking in the SERPs.
  2. Use header tags: Use header tags (H1, H2, etc.) to structure your content and make it easier for both users and search engines to understand the main points and hierarchy of your content.
  3. Use internal and external links: Link to other relevant pages on your website (internal links) and to external sources (external links) to provide more information for your readers and to show search engines that your content is well-researched and credible.
  4. Use alt tags for images: Use alt tags to describe the images on your website. This can help search engines understand the content of your images and improve the accessibility of your website for users who are using screen readers.
  5. Use tools to check your SEO: There are many tools available that can help you check the SEO of your content, such as the SEO Analysis tool in Google Search Console and the SEO Writing Assistant in SEMrush. These tools can help you identify issues with your content and suggest ways to improve it.

By following these tips and using the right tools, you can create SEO-friendly content that is both user-friendly and optimized for search engines.

2.Add links to previous content

Linking to previous content on your website, also known as internal linking, can be a useful strategy for improving the SEO of your website. Internal linking helps search engines understand the structure and hierarchy of your content and can also help improve the user experience by providing additional information and context for readers.

Here are some tips for using internal linking effectively:

  1. Link to relevant content: Only link to pages on your website that are relevant to the content you are currently writing. This will help search engines understand the content of the linked pages and improve their ranking.
  2. Use descriptive anchor text: Use descriptive anchor text that accurately reflects the content of the linked page. This will help search engines understand the content of the linked page and improve its ranking.
  3. Use internal linking to distribute link equity: Link equity is the value that is passed from one page to another through links. By using internal linking, you can distribute link equity throughout your website, which can help improve the overall SEO of your site.
  4. Use internal linking to improve the user experience: Internal linking can help improve the user experience by providing additional information and context for readers. Use internal linking to guide readers through your content and help them find related information.

By following these tips, you can effectively use internal linking to improve the SEO of your website and enhance the user experience.

4.Choose your keywords wisely

Choosing the right keywords is an important aspect of search engine optimization (SEO). Keywords are the words and phrases that people use when searching for information on the internet, and using relevant keywords in your content can help improve its 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s).

Here are some tips for choosing keywords wisely:

  1. Identify your target audience: Consider who your target audience is and what they might be searching for. This will help you identify the keywords that are most relevant to your business.
  2. Use keyword research tools: There are many tools available that can help you research and identify relevant keywords, such as the Google Keyword Planner and SEMrush. These tools can provide information on the search volume and competitiveness of different keywords.
  3. Use long-tail keywords: Long-tail keywords are more specific and less competitive than short-tail keywords. They may have lower search volume, but they can be more effective at driving targeted traffic to your website.
  4. Use a mix of keywords: Don’t rely on just one or two keywords – use a mix of related keywords to ensure that your content is optimized for a range of search queries.
  5. Use keywords naturally: Don’t stuff your content with keywords – use them naturally and in a way that flows with the rest of your content. This will help improve the readability and user experience of your website.

By following these tips, you can choose your keywords wisely and improve the SEO of your website.

5.Optimize your images.

Optimizing your images is an important aspect of search engine optimization (SEO). Properly optimized images can improve the loading speed of your website, which can help improve its 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s). In addition, properly optimized images can improve the user experience of your website by making it more visually appealing and easier to navigate.

Here are some tips for optimizing your images:

  1. Use appropriate file types: Use image file types such as JPEG, PNG, or GIF that are appropriate for the type of image you are using. For example, JPEG is a good choice for photographs, while PNG is a good choice for graphics with transparent backgrounds.
  2. Use descriptive, keyword-rich file names: Use descriptive, keyword-rich file names for your images. This can help search engines understand the content of your images and improve their ranking in the SERPs.
  3. Use alt tags: Use alt tags to describe the content of your images. Alt tags are text descriptions that are displayed when an image is not available or when a user is using a screen reader. Using alt tags can improve the accessibility of your website for users with disabilities and can also help improve the SEO of your images.
  4. Compress your images: Use image compression tools to reduce the file size of your images without sacrificing quality. This can help improve the loading speed of your website.

By following these tips, you can optimize your images to improve the SEO and user experience of your website.

8.Content optimization tools

There are many tools available that can help you optimize your content for search engine optimization (SEO). These tools can help you identify issues with your content and suggest ways to improve it. Here are some examples of content optimization tools:

  1. Google Search Console: Google Search Console is a free tool provided by Google that allows you to see how your website is performing in search results. It provides information on your website’s search traffic, errors, and crawl data, and it also includes an SEO Analysis tool that can help you identify issues with your content and suggest ways to improve it.
  2. SEMrush: SEMrush is a paid tool that provides a range of SEO and content marketing tools, including the SEO Writing Assistant. The SEO Writing Assistant analyzes your content for SEO and provides suggestions for improvement, such as using relevant keywords and improving the readability of your content.
  3. Yoast SEO: Yoast SEO is a WordPress plugin that provides a range of SEO tools, including a content analysis tool. The content analysis tool analyzes your content for SEO and provides suggestions for improvement, such as using header tags and optimizing the length of your content.
  4. Copyscape: Copyscape is a tool that helps you detect and prevent plagiarism. It can be used to ensure that your content is original and not copied from other sources.

By using these types of tools, you can optimize your content for SEO and improve the visibility and performance of your website in search results.
